Three human MGSA/GRO genes encode 3 highly related chemokines, MGSA/GRO alpha, -beta and -gamma. All 3 MGSA/GRO proteins bind to the same receptors, but with differing affinities, and stimulate a number of biological responses including chemotaxis, angiogenesis, and growth regulation.
Biological Activity:
GRO-beta is fully biologically active when compared to standard. The Biological activity is calculated by its ability to chemoattract CXCR2 transfected 293 cells using 10.0-100.0ng/ml.

Storage and Stability:
Lyophilized powder may be stored at -20 degrees C. Stable for 12 months at -20 degrees C. Reconstitute with sterile ddH2O. For long term storage it is recommended to add a carrier protein (0.1% HSA or BSA). Aliquot to avoid repeated freezing and thawing. Store at -20 degrees C. For maximum recovery of product, centrifuge the original vial after thawing and prior to removing the cap. Further dilutions can be made in assay buffer.
